Okay, so I dug around and found that there is actually no difference in terms of friendly fire scoring modifiers across the different difficulty modes, so that would be unrelated. This means it's unlikely there's a bug here since we do have plenty of feedback and runs as far as Rogue mode goes.

It's likely more a question of play style. Destroying or even just damaging allies can be extremely bad for your score if you do it at all frequently (especially depending on what you hit them with!) It's also possible you might feel more invincible and therefore reckless in a non-Rogue difficulty mode, leading to more collateral damage :P

Some of the negative score modifiers are pretty huge, and can stack up fast! With a scoresheet we could probably see more details, but I'm pretty sure that's it. Just stop shooting allies and your score will be much happier for it xD
